Overview

Devastated at the death of her four-year-old daughter, a grieving middle school teacher is horrified to discover that her students aren't as innocent as she thinks.

How It Feels

Read from this film's synopsis, keywords and credits, and used to work out what it sits beside.

A methodical, psychologically devastating revenge thriller where a grieving mother systematically dismantles the lives of those responsible for her daughter's death. The film pulls you into moral ambiguity, questioning whether justice and vengeance can ever be the same thing.
